Starbucks union turns up pressure with strikes, gift card boycott
December 20, 2022 // On Dec. 14, the union announced a campaign to persuade customers not to buy gift cards this year. Unused gift cards and money loaded onto the Starbucks app boost the company’s profitability — funds accounted for $196 million in revenue for Starbucks in the last year, according to Starbucks’ 10-K. The combination of a targeted product boycott and multi-day strikes at stores across the country constitutes a strategic escalation by the union to push Starbucks toward the bargaining table, workers and labor experts say.
